Polymorphisms in the gene encoding CD2-associated protein (CD2AP) are associated with an increased risk for developing Alzheimer's disease (AD). Intriguingly, variants also cause a pattern of kidney injury termed focal segmental glomerulosclerosis. Recent studies have investigated cell types and mechanisms by which CD2AP dosage contributes to key pathological features AD.
